Gah, was still testing the STUDIO pc. Booted to UBUNTU and had Clementine play a l-o-n-g playlist (all the files of which are on the second drive). Sure enough, the screen cut out while I was in the middle of posting to FB.
But then I thought "What if it's the new power board?" See I bought a powerboard that has master/slave outlets. When the master one has an appliance on it that gets turned off, the slave outlets get turned off as well. Maybe there's a power saving function on the PC that FOOLS the power board into thinking the master is turned off. That would explain the mystery blackouts this week (which didn't happen with the old power board).
Swapped in a new manual powerboard. Switches for each outlet. We'll see. So far Ubuntu had no trouble, but I don't know about windows yet.
